Ubuntu 16.04 Minecraft Server Kurma

Adım 1 – Java ve Screen kurulumu

Başlamadan önce, SSH ile sunucunuza bağlanmanız gerekir. Sunucunuza giriş yapmak için terminali açın (veya Windows’daysanız Putty SSH Terminalini kullanın) ve aşağıdaki komutu yazın:

ssh username@ipaddress

Bir kez giriş yaptıktan sonra, Minecraft server kurma işlemine başlayabilirsiniz.

Minecraft sunucu kurulumu, Java’nın sisteminize kurulu olmasını gerektirir. Bunu yapmak için aşağıdaki adımları izleyin:

  1. Aslında sisteminizde Java zaten yüklü olabilir. Bunu kontrol etmek için aşağıdaki komutu çalıştırın:
    java -version

    Java’nın sisteminizde bulunmadığını bildiren bir mesaj alırsanız, bu adımların geri kalanını izlemeye devam edebilirsiniz. Aksi halde, bu bölümle işiniz bitmiştir ve 2. adıma geçebilirsiniz.

  2. Sisteminizde Java da dahil olmak üzere en son yüklenen yazılım paketlerini indirmek için terminalinizde aşağıdaki komutu çalıştırın:
    sudo apt-get install openjdk-7-jdk
  3. Şimdi Java yüklemeniz gerekiyor. Bu eğiticide Java 17’yi kuruyoruz:
    sudo apt-get install default-jdk
  4. Java’nın en son sürümünü kullanmak istiyorsanız, yukarıdaki komut yerine aşağıdakini çalıştırabilirsiniz:
    sudo apt-get install default-jdk
  5. Ayrıca, sunucunuza bağlantıyı kesseniz bile arka planda çalışmaya devam etmesini sağlayacak Screen’i kurmalısınız. Bunu yapmak için aşağıdakini yazın ve yürütün:
    sudo apt-get install screen

Artık sisteminizde Java ve Screen kurulu olmalıdır.

Adım 2 – Ubuntu Minecraft Server Kurma

Ön koşulları aradan çıkardığımıza göre şimdi Minecraft sunucusunu Ubuntu VPS’e kurmaya odaklanabiliriz. Bunu yapmak için, aşağıdaki adımları takip edin:

  1. Her şeyi temiz ve düzenli tutmak daha iyidir. Karışıklık yaratmamak için tüm Minecraft dosyalarınızı bir yerde saklayacak yeni bir dizin oluşturun. Bu adımu uygulamanız tavsiye edilir, ancak tamamen isteğe bağlıdır. Yeni bir dizin oluşturmak için şunu çalıştırın:
    mkdir minecraft
  2. Oluşturduktan sonra, aşağıdakileri yazarak yeni oluşturulan dizinin içine girin:
    cd minecraft
  3. Sisteminizde wget zaten bulunuyor olması gerekir. Yüklü değilse, aşağıdaki komutu çalıştırmanız yeterlidir:
    sudo apt-get install wget
  4. Şimdi kendi Minecraft sunucunuzu indirin ve yükleyin:
    wget -O minecraft_server.jar https://s3.amazonaws.com/Minecraft.Download/versions/1.11.2/minecraft_server.1.11.2.jar

    Bu rehberi hazırlarken mevcut en son sürüm 1.11.2’dir. Bu sürüm numarasını, o anki en son sürümün ne olduğu ile değiştirmelisiniz. En son sürümü kontrol etmek için bu bağlantıyı ziyaret edin.

  5. Minecraft’ın son kullanıcı lisans sözleşmesini kabul edin:
    echo "eula=true" > eula.txt
  6. Sunucunun arka planda çalışabilmesi için Screen’i açın ve çalıştırın:
    screen -S "Minecraft server 1"

    Geçerli oturumu ‘Minecraft server 1’ olarak adlandırdık, bunun yerine başka bir ad da kullanabilirsiniz.

İşte bu kadar – özel Minecraft server kurma işlemini Ubuntu’da başarıyla tamamladınız.

Adım 3 – Minecraft Sunucusunu Çalıştırma

Şimdi yalnızca kurulu sunucuyu çalıştırmanız yeterlidir. Bunu yapmak için, terminalde aşağıdakini çalıştırın:

java -Xmx1024M -Xms1024M -jar minecraft_server.jar nogui

Gördüğünüz gibi Minecraft, sunucunuzu başlatmak için 1024MB veya 1GB RAM’e sahip olmanızı gerektiriyor. Bu minimum gereksinim olmasına rağmen, daha iyi performans için daha fazla RAM bulundurmanızı öneririz. Örneğin, sunucuya daha fazla bellek ayırmak için 1024’ü -Xmx ve -Xms parametrelerinde 2048 (2GB) ile değiştirmeniz yeterlidir.

Artık sizin de dakikalar içerisinde kurduğunuz Minecraft sunucunuz var. Screen kullandığımız için sunucu arka planda çalışıyor. Screen’den çıkmak için önce CTRL + A, ardından D tuşluşuna basın. Bunu geri almak içinse ve terminalde screen -r yazarak Screen penceresini yeniden açabilirsiniz.

Son olarak, sunucu özellik dosyasını düzenleyerek sunucunuzun ayarlarıyla oynayabilirsiniz:

nano ~/minecraft/server.properties